Downspout reattachment services involve securing and reinstalling loose or detached downspouts to ensure proper drainage away from the property. Over time, weather conditions, settling foundations, or improper initial installation can cause downspouts to become disconnected or fall out of place. Skilled service providers use specialized tools and techniques to reattach downspouts securely, restoring their function and preventing potential water damage. This service is essential for maintaining the integrity of a home’s gutter system and ensuring effective water runoff during heavy rains.
Many common problems can be addressed through downspout reattachment. When downspouts are loose or detached, water may spill over the sides or pool near the foundation, increasing the risk of basement flooding, erosion, or foundation issues. Additionally, loose downspouts can cause water to flow onto walkways, driveways, or landscaping, leading to erosion or damage. Reattaching downspouts helps keep water directed away from the home’s foundation and landscaping, reducing the likelihood of costly repairs and property damage.

The overview below groups typical Downspout Reattachment proj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Warren, OH.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ine downspout reattachment jobs in Warren, OH range from $250 to $600. Many minor fixes fall within this middle range, covering standard repairs on a few sections of guttering. Fewer projects will push into the higher end of this spectrum unless additional work is needed.
Moderate Reattachments - For more extensive reattachment projects involving multiple sections or minor modifications,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,200. This range accounts for larger areas or slightly more complex installations, which are common for residential properties.
Larger or Complex Jobs - Larger projects, such as reattaching multiple downspouts across an entire property or dealing with difficult access points, can cost from $1,200 to $3,000. These tend to be less frequent but are necessary for comprehensive gutter system repairs on bigger homes or commercial buildings.
Full Replacement or Major Repairs - Complete downspout reattachment or replacement projects in Warren, OH typically exceed $3,000, with larger, more complex jobs reaching $5,000 or more. These are less common and usually involve significant structural work or custom solutions for extensive gutter system upgrades.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is downspout reattachment? Downspout reattachment involves securing loose or detached downspouts back to the building’s exterior to ensure proper water drainage and prevent damage.
Why might a downspout need reattachment? A downspout may require reattachment if it becomes loose, detached after storms, or shows signs of sagging and improper alignment.
How do local contractors perform downspout reattachment? Skilled service providers typically secure downspouts using appropriate fasteners, check for proper drainage angles, and ensure they are firmly attached to the building.
Can reattaching a downspout prevent water damage? Yes, properly reattached downspouts help direct water away from the foundation, reducing the risk of water damage and basement flooding.
What signs indicate a downspout needs reattachment? Visible detachment, sagging, or water spilling from the sides of the downspout are common signs that it may need to be reattached by a local contractor.
